U.S. Wheat Donation arrives in Jordan
American Deputy Chief of Mission and Minister of Industry and Trade marked the arrival of 50,000 metric tons of American wheat, valued commercially at $13.3 million and donated by the U.S. government to the people of Jordan.

U.S. grants three C-130 cargo aircraft to Jordan
Amman, December 19. In a ceremony attended by U.S. Ambassador to Jordan Stuart Jones, Lt. Gen. HRH Prince Faisal bin Al Hussein and other Jordanian officials, the United States handed over two C-130E cargo aircraft to the Royal Jordanian Air Force.

$275 Million Grant to Jordan from the MCC
Amman, December 18. U.S. and Jordan announced the entry into force of a $275.1 million grant agreement from the US Government’s Millennium Challenge Corporation (MCC) to the Hashemite Kingdom of Jordan.
